Grilled Peaches with Raspberry Sauce and Lemon Cream

Raspberry sauce makes a seductive topping for these warm, beautifully caramelized peaches, but a dollop of lemon-flavored whipped cream is the pièce de résistance. A combination you could call triumphant.

For the sauce:

3

 

cups fresh raspberries or 1 twelve-ounce bag frozen raspberries, thawed

1

 

tablespoon fresh lemon juice

1

 

tablespoon tequila or raspberry liqueur (optional)

2 to 4

 

tablespoons granulated sugar

For the lemon cream:

1

 

cup heavy cream, cold

1

 

tablespoon superfine instant dissolving sugar

2

 

teaspoons finely grated lemon zest

1

 

tablespoon fresh lemon juice


For the peaches:

6

 

large peaches, firm but ripe

6

 

tablespoons unsalted butter

1/4

 

cup granulated sugar

To make the raspberry sauce: In a blender or food processor fitted with the metal blade, purée the raspberries with 1/3 cup of water. Strain purée through a fine-mesh sieve into a bowl, pressing on the pulp to extract the liquid. A few seeds may pass through the sieve and remain in the sauce. Add the lemon juice, tequila (if desired), and the sugar to taste. (Fresh raspberries will likely need the full amount of sugar; sweetened frozen berries will require less.) Stir or whisk until the sugar dissolves. Refrigerate until ready to serve.

To make the lemon cream: In a mixing bowl, mix the cream and sugar together. Whip the cream at high speed until it reaches soft peaks. Add the rest of the lemon cream ingredients and continue whipping at high speed until the cream reaches stiff peaks. Set aside in the refrigerator.

To prepare the peaches: Halve and pit the peaches; set aside. Melt the butter in a small saucepan, then add the sugar and stir until the sugar is dissolved. Remove pan from heat. Brush peach halves all over with the butter mixture.

Grill the peach halves over Direct Medium heat until they are browned in spots and warm throughout, 8 to 10 minutes, turning them every two or three minutes. Serve the peaches warm with the raspberry sauce and lemon cream.

MAKES 6 SERVINGS
